AARP Utah to Host ‘Meet the Candidates’ Barbecue on August 31

AARP Utah is hosting a “Meet the Candidates” Barbecue on Wednesday, August 31 to provide members with an opportunity to hear directly from those running for office about their views concerning issues facing people 50+.  

Particular concerns in Utah include support for caregivers, creation of workplace retirement savings plans, and expansion of Medicaid.

At the national level, AARP is engaged in a campaign around itsTake a Stand initiative, which focuses on pressing presidential candidates Donald Trump and Hillary Clinton to lay out their plans to update Social Security so that it’s financially sound with adequate benefits for generations to come.  Members of Congress are also being asked to make Social Security a priority and put serious proposals on the table.
